Data sources


Here are a number of data sources that provide network data as well as links to other data sources:

  • Stanford Network Analysis Project (SNAP) has a website http://snap.stanford.edu/data/links.html with links to many network datasets (large and small).

  • Mark Newman is one of the most recognized network scientists who maintains a number of network datasets at his site http://www-personal.umich.edu/~mejn/netdata/.

  • Albert-László Barabási is one of the foremost network scientists and runs the Barabasi Lab at Northeastern University. More information about him can be found at http://barabasilab.com/rs-netdb.php.

  • The Gephi wiki has many network datasets as well as a number of files that are already in various proprietary formats. These can be found at https://wiki.gephi.org/index.php/Datasets.

  • KONECT is the Koblenz Network Collection available at the University of Koblenz-Landau. The University's site houses one of the best collections of network data, and provides easily accessible symbols that identify specific network attributes, which can be found at http://konect.uni-koblenz.de/.
